This impressive English Tudor home was built in 1933. The architect was Robert E Jenks who went on to design the Spencer Museum of Art and the Spencer Research Library at the University of Kansas. Original detailing has been meticulously maintained, including peg and groove oak flooring in the Entry, Living Room and Dining Room. Other unique features include wrought iron fixtures and custom cabinets and hardware from the Pullman Company. The original blueprints will be passed on to the new owners!
